right before my belt went in my old scrambler, the loose flapping pieces of belt were hitting the cover from the inside, but only when I slowed to a stop. The belt shredded and blew apart pretty quickly. As I remember, I heard the same noise when I slowed down for 3 or 4 road crossings, kept going about a mile and all of a sudden all I had was neutral, neutral, and neutral. I would say that something is inside your housing, it could be foreign debris or a mouse or something, but I would bet on the belt starting to disintegrate. Replace it before you have to walk home.
